    "One [candidate] was Tablo and the other was RM. But the reason I didn’t ask Tablo and went straight to RM was because I thought that Namjoon would do a good job. And he had a very firm stance too. When we discussed this song, and when he asked what the theme was, I just sent him the lyrics [verse 1]. And I told him to write whatever comes to his mind. And he said, "if it doesn’t work out, you can get someone else to write it". … At first, he seemed to feel burdened. … He asked if it was OK for someone with vested rights to talk about such things. And I told him that he could write that in his lyrics. … *The lyrics turned out really well. "A round nail stuck in a square hole". Wow, this is something that only Kim Namjoon could write. I was amazed when I read the lyrics. I thought that he did a really good job. And that I did a good job in asking him. That’s what I thought." - Yoongi a.k.a. SUGA a.k.a. Agust D [V LIVE]*

SUGA said on his vlive when talking abt the behind for D2 that RM first had doubts on if he should do the song thinking wouldn't it be hypocritical of him criticizing the system when he can be considered as part of the rich top of the system so SUGA said then write that, whatever your thoughts are just write it so that's why it can explain why RM decided to write the line it doesn't matter whether you are rich, you're still a slave to the system. And now we have this deep introspective song where they compliment each other yet at the same time feel a bit contradictory with the sick & unsick, eyes open or closed, the polarization flower SUGA saying is ugly but RM saying well it has already bloomed hasn't it? Even the line about one who wants peace & the one who wants war, are both at the opposite ends of their ideal but possibly want to achieve the same thing only with different means.     this is why I like AGUST D he is really brave and speaks about some really interesting topics, about the meaning of life or how the world works or human psychology, mental health etc..and sometimes just like this song he left the song meanings up to his fans and he said about it that he wanted listeners to really think about the song's lyrics.. because he presents many angles to view the problem from, RM verse too and what RM did is that he tried to answer the questions that AGUST D did from his point of view. which makes it more special...
    this is what Suga said
    "I just throw the question mark; it’s up to each individual to decide. In my personal opinion, it’s often better for those who have such influence on others to be wary of loudly voicing their biased views," which shows you that you really shouldn’t confine yourself to one answer alone and he wants you to be able to form your own opinions about society.
